ABSTRACT This retrospective cohort study preliminarily investigated the feasibility of implementing primary aldosteronism (PA) screening without discontinuing dihydropyridine calcium channel blockers (DHP‐CCBs). We screened all patients undergoing diagnostic testing for secondary hypertension from January 2017 to May 2022 at authors’ center. For inclusion, patients must be on DHP‐CCBs monotherapy for hypertension. Aldosterone and renin concentration were measured pre‐ and post‐washout. Confirmatory tests were conducted in patients with positive screen [combination of ARR >2.5 (ng/dL)/(μIU/mL), aldosterone ≥10 ng/dL, and renin ≤8.2 μIU/mL] after washout. The final analysis included a total of 198 patients (median age: 49.5 years and 117 men). Confirmatory tests identified PA in 31 (15.7%) patients. Aldosterone‐to‐renin ratio (ARR) increased in 158 (79.8%) patients after washout. In 168 patients with a negative pre‐washout screen, 22 turned positive after washout, and 14 were diagnosed PA. Consequently, the missed diagnosis rate of PA was 45.2% (14/31) when using standard positive screen criteria before washout of DHP‐CCBs monotherapy. Exploratory analysis indicated that a pre‐washout ARR cutoff of >1.2 (ng/dL)/(μIU/mL) demonstrated 0.97 sensitivity and 0.75 specificity. In conclusions, caution is warranted when interpretating screening results from patients on DHP‐CCBs monotherapy due to the potential risk of missed diagnosis. Preliminary data suggest that ARR ≤1.2 (ng/dL)/(μIU/mL) before washout may serve as a candidate threshold for excluding PA in these patients, though this observation remains a hypothesis‐generating finding that requires further investigation.
Background:Heart failure (HF) is a serious clinical syndrome with substantial health threats. Emerging studies link intestinal flora dysbiosis to HF onset and progression. Although probiotics are thought to regulate gut microbiota, the specific impact of probiotics on HF remains unclear, highlighting the need for systematic evaluation. Methods:As of 9 September 2025, we searched eight major academic databases using a predefined protocol for data extraction and quality assessment. Subsequently, a meta-analysis was conducted using Review Manager 5.4 and Stata 18. Forest plots were used to analyse the effect size, and publication bias was evaluated through funnel plots. Results:Ultimately, 11 of the studies met the inclusion criteria for the systematic review. The results showed that probiotics have a slight beneficial effect on cardiac function indicators (LVEF, LVESV), reduced the levels of inflammatory factors (hs-CRP, IL-6, TNF-α), regulated the proportion of dominant gut bacteria, and decreased the readmission rates of patients with HF. However, no beneficial effects were found on NT-proBNP, activity endurance, TMAO, and mortality. Conclusion:Probiotics exert cardioprotective effects and can serve as adjunctive therapy for HF management. Future high-quality, large-sample clinical studies are needed to further clarify their long-term efficacy and optimal intervention strategies. Systematic review registration:Details of the protocol for this systematic review were registered on PROSPERO (CRD420251083960).
Patients who undergo adrenalectomy for unilateral primary aldosteronism (PA) may still develop post-surgery hypertension; however, the clinical characteristics and etiology of patients developing recurrent hypertension after adrenalectomy are unclear. We analyzed the records of 43 patients with recurrent elevated blood pressure after adrenalectomy, who were treated at our center. Standard routine clinical screening workup was used to identify the cause of recurrent hypertension. Causes of recurrent hypertension after adrenalectomy included essential hypertension, primary aldosteronism, obstructive sleep apnea, renal artery stenosis, and Takayasu arteritis. Before adrenalectomy, 39.5% of patients were diagnosed with confirmed or suspected PA, primarily through CT imaging. Adrenal venous sampling (AVS) tests were not conducted on any patients, and 72.1% patients underwent partial adrenalectomy. Among all patients, elevated blood pressure was observed in 44.2% immediately post-operation, 18.6% within 1 month, 16.3% in 1–6 months, and 20.9% >6 months after operation. Most patients had hypertension of grade 2 and above. Standard endocrine functional assessment and AVS tests should be performed before adrenalectomy to ensure more accurate diagnosis and favorable post-operative outcomes. Additionally, individuals often develop essential hypertension regardless of past adrenal disease.
Abstract Background The triglyceride-glucose (TyG) index is a reliable marker of insulin resistance that is involved in the progression of hypertension. This study aimed to evaluate the association of the TyG index with the risk for major cardiovascular events (MACE) in young adult hypertension. Methods A total of 2,651 hypertensive patients aged 18–40 years were consecutively enrolled in this study. The TyG index was calculated as Ln [triglycerides × fasting plasma glucose/2]. The cutoff value for an elevated TyG index was determined to be 8.43 by receiver-operating characteristic curve analysis. The primary endpoint was MACE, which was a composite of all-cause death, non-fatal myocardial infarction, coronary revascularization, non-fatal stroke, and end-stage renal dysfunction. The secondary endpoints were individual MACE components. Results During the median follow-up time of 2.6 years, an elevated TyG index was associated with markedly increased risk of MACE (adjusted hazard ratio [HR] 3.440, P < 0.001) in young hypertensive adults. In subgroup analysis, the elevated TyG index predicted an even higher risk of MACE in women than men (adjusted HR 6.329 in women vs. adjusted HR 2.762 in men, P for interaction, 0.001); and in patients with grade 2 (adjusted HR 3.385) or grade 3 (adjusted HR 4.168) of hypertension than those with grade 1 (P for interaction, 0.024). Moreover, adding the elevated TyG index into a recalibrated Systematic COronary Risk Evaluation 2 model improved its ability to predict MACE. Conclusions An elevated TyG index is associated with a higher risk of MACE in young adult hypertension, particularly in women and those with advanced hypertension. Regular evaluation of the TyG index facilitates the identification of high-risk patients. Graphical abstract
OBJECTIVE:The aim of this study is to evaluate performance of aldosterone-to-renin ratio (ARR) before washout of antihypertensive drugs as a screening test for primary aldosteronism (PA). METHODS:This retrospective analysis included consecutive patients screening for secondary hypertension during a period from January 2017 to May 2022 at the authors' institute. For inclusion in the final analysis, ARR had to be available prior to as well as after discontinuation of antihypertensives. Patients with ARR ≥2.4(ng/dL)/(μIU/mL) after washout proceeded to confirmatory tests. Diagnosis of PA was established based on a positive result of the confirmatory test. The diagnostic accuracy of ARR prior to the washout in predicting PA is shown as sensitivity, specificity, positive predictive value (PPV), and negative predictive value (NPV). RESULTS:The analysis included a total of 1306 patients [median age of 50.2 (41.0-59.0) years, 64.0% male]. Confirmatory tests showed PA in 215(16.5%) patients and essential hypertension (EH) in the remaining 1091(83.5%) patients. In comparison to the second screening test, the first screening test (before washout of antihypertensives) yielded lower plasma aldosterone and higher renin and consequently lower ARR in both the PA and EH groups. At a cutoff of .7(ng/dL)/(μIU/mL), ARR before washout had 96.3% sensitivity, 61.2% specificity, .33 PPV, and .99 NPV. At a lower cutoff of .5(ng/dL)/(μIU/mL), the sensitivity, specificity, PPV, and NPV were 97.7%, 52.0%, .29, and .99, respectively. CONCLUSION:ARR prior to washout of antihypertensives is a sensitive screening test for PA. Washout of antihypertensives could be omitted and further investigation for PA is not warranted if ARR is ≤ .7(ng/dL)/(μIU/mL) before washout.
Cardiac paragangliomas (PGLs) are rare neuroendocrine tumors, and data regarding the features of nonfunctioning PGLs are limited. These tumors are extensively vascularized and have high risk of hemorrhage for surgery and even biopsy. Differential diagnosis including biochemical analysis of these PGLs is important for further management. In this case report, we present the clinical, laboratory, imaging, and radionuclide presentations of a rare primary nonfunctioning cardiac PGL with a coronary aneurysm. Echocardiography initially showed a large echogenic mass in the left atrioventricular groove. The mass presented a diffuse hyperenhancement pattern with a central perfusion defect on contrast echocardiography. The tumor enclosed the left coronary artery from the coronary orifice, and an aneurysm was found in the left circumflex artery, with significantly increased flow velocity. These echocardiographic features and its susceptible location are indicative of the presence of a cardiac PGL. Although all biochemical evaluations of catecholamines from blood and urine samples were negative, positron emission tomography and scintigraphy finally confirmed the diagnosis of a primary cardiac PGL. Therefore, when imaging features are indicative of the presence of PGLs, the implementation of radionuclide imaging for final diagnosis is required even if the biochemical results are negative. Recognizing these uncommon Doppler and contrast echocardiographic characteristics is important for early diagnosing these nonfunctioning PGLs.

Background: Mid-aortic syndrome (MAS), characterized by segmental stricture of the distal thoracic and abdominal aorta, is a heterogeneous clinical syndrome with multiple etiologies. Methods: We retrospectively analyzed 143 consecutive patients (99 females and 44 males, mean age 40.93 +/- 15.31 years) with MAS seen from January 1, 2010 to January 1, 2019. Results: Takayasu arteritis (76.9%, 110/143) and atherosclerosis (19.6%, 28/143) were the most-common causes. There were also one patient with Beh,cet's disease and one with congenital MAS in the cohort. Hypertension was the most -com-mon manifestation. Constitutional symptoms were mainly seen in Takayasu arteritis, and neurological, gastrointestinal and vascular symptoms were common in both Takayasu arteritis and atherosclerosis. The infrarenal segment was the most -commonly involved in atherosclerosis (89.3%, 25/28), whereas lesions were more distributed in Takayasu arteritis. The mean length of involved segments was longer (43.45 +/- 23.64 mm vs. 30.68 +/- 12.66 mm; P = 0.018) and the degree of ste-nosis was lower (80.20 +/- 13.36% vs. 87.50 +/- 13.95%, P = 0.004) in Takayasu arteritis than atherosclerosis. The most -common concurrently involved branch was the renal artery, followed by the celiac trunk and mesenteric arteries, in both Takayasu arteritis (51.8%, 32.7% and 27.3%, respectively) and atherosclerosis (53.6%, 25.0% and 17.9%, respectively). Concurrent artery involvement and coexisting lesions were absent in MAS caused by congenial coarctation of the abdomi-nal aorta and Beh,cet's disease. Conclusions: Takayasu arteritis and atherosclerosis were the most-common causes of MAS among these adults. Imaging tests provided evidence of involved segments and luminal and mural changes, aiding conclusive diagnoses and etiological dif-ferentiation of MAS. [Am J Med Sci 2023;365(5):420-428.]
ObjectiveTo examine the consistency of plasma aldosterone concentration at 1 and 2 h in the captopril challenge test (CCT) and to explore the possibility of replacing 2-h aldosterone concentration with 1-h aldosterone concentration for diagnosis of primary aldosteronism (PA).MethodsThis retrospective analysis included a total of 204 hypertensive patients suspected of having PA. Subjects received oral captopril challenge at 50 mg (25 mg if the systolic blood pressure was <120 mmHg), and plasma aldosterone concentration and direct renin concentration were measured at 1 and 2 h afterward (chemiluminescence immunoassay Liaison® DiaSorin, Italy). Sensitivity and specificity were used to reflect the diagnostic performance of 1-h aldosterone concentration using 2-h aldosterone concentration (11 ng/dl as the cutoff) as the reference. A receiver operating characteristic curve analysis was also conducted.ResultsAmong the 204 included patients [median age of 57.0 (48.0–61.0) years, 54.4% men], a diagnosis of PA was established in 94 patients. Aldosterone concentration in the patients with essential hypertension was 8.40 (interquartile range 7.05–11.00) ng/dl at 1 h and 7.65 (5.98–9.30) ng/dl at 2 h (P < 0.001). In patients with PA, aldosterone concentration was 16.80 (12.58–20.50) ng/dl at 1 h and 15.55 (12.60–20.85) ng/dl at 2 h (P > 0.999). At a cutoff of 11 ng/dl, the sensitivity and specificity of using 1-h aldosterone concentration to diagnose PA were 87.2% and 78.2%, respectively. A higher cutoff of 12.5 ng/ml increased specificity to 90.0% but decreased sensitivity to 75.5%. A lower cutoff of 9.3 ng/ml increased sensitivity to 97.9% but decreased specificity to 65.4%.ConclusionsWhen diagnosing PA with CCT, 1-h aldosterone concentration could not be used to replace 2-h aldosterone concentration.
Purpose This study aimed to explore the impact of ABL1–tyrosine kinase inhibitors (TKIs) adherence on the survival of chromosome-positive (Ph+) acute lymphoblastic leukemia (ALL) children and clarify the potential predictors of patients’ prognosis from TKIs intake practices.Materials and Methods Ninety newly diagnosed Ph+ ALL patients who received TKIs were enrolled. We collected the baseline characteristics and adverse events in all children; moreover, TKIs adherence was measured by an eight-item Morisky medication adherence scale (MMAS-8). Progression-free survival (PFS) and overall survival (OS) analysis were performed, and risk factors for PFS and OS were evaluated.Results Among all patients, 69 cases were regarded as adherers, while 21 were non-adherers. The median duration of TKIs interruption was significantly prolonged in the non-adherence group than in the adherence group (13 [0-101] vs. 56 [11-128], p < 0.001). Additionally, dose reduction occurred in 55.2% of non-adherers versus 23.0% of adherers (p=0.002). The PFS and OS in adherers were significantly higher versus non-adherers (p=0.020 and p=0.039). MMAS-8 score was an independent risk factor for PFS (p=0.010) and OS (p=0.031). Among non-adherers, the median OS was only 23.1% (4.2%-42%) in patients aged ≤ 10 years versus 54.4% (38.8%-70%) in adolescents. Most of the patients who experienced TKIs non-adherence suffered pancytopenia.Conclusion TKIs adherence during treatment significantly influenced the survival of pediatric Ph+ ALL patients, and non-adherers with age ≤ 10 years were more vulnerable to TKIs disruption. The cumulative TKIs dose should be especially emphasized to patients with age ≤ 10 years, which may result in an inferior achievement of relevant treatment milestones.
Background: Clinical data on the correlation of dyslipidaemia with the long-term outcomes of ulcerative colitis (UC) are limited. This study aimed to evaluate the impact of lipid levels on disease activity and prognosis in UC. Methods: The retrospective data of UC patients who had detailed lipid profiles were collected from January 2003 to September 2020. All patients were followed-up to 30 September 2021. The long-term outcomes were UC-related surgery and tumorigenesis. Results: In total, 497 patients were included in the analysis. Compared to patients with normal lipid levels, those with dyslipidaemia commonly presented with more serious disease activity. Low high-density lipoprotein cholesterol (p < 0.05) levels were associated with higher risks of severe disease activity in UC. Regarding the long-term outcomes, patients with persistent dyslipidaemia were at higher risks of UC-related surgery (HR: 3.27, 95% CI: 1.86–5.75, p < 0.001) and tumorigenesis (HR: 7.92, 95% CI: 3.97–15.78, p < 0.001) and had shorter surgery- and tumour-free survival (p < 0.001) than patients with transient dyslipidaemia and normal lipid levels. Low levels of high-density lipoprotein cholesterol (p < 0.001) and apolipoprotein A1 (p < 0.05) were associated with higher risks of surgery and tumorigenesis. Conclusion: Persistent dyslipidaemia was associated with a higher risk of serious disease activity and worse long-term outcomes among patients with UC. Lipid patterns should be assessed to improve the management of high-risk patients with UC in the early phase.
ObjectiveMounting evidence has linked microbiome and metabolome to systemic autoimmunity and cardiovascular diseases (CVDs). Takayasu arteritis (TAK) is a rare disease that shares features of immune‐related inflammatory diseases and CVDs, about which there is relatively limited information. This study was undertaken to characterize gut microbial dysbiosis and its crosstalk with phenotypes in TAK.MethodsTo address the discriminatory signatures, we performed shotgun sequencing of fecal metagenome across a discovery cohort (n = 97) and an independent validation cohort (n = 75) including TAK patients, healthy controls, and controls with Behçet's disease (BD). Interrogation of untargeted metabolomics and lipidomics profiling of plasma and fecal samples were also used to refine features mediating associations between microorganisms and TAK phenotypes.ResultsA combined model of bacterial species, including unclassified Escherichia, Veillonella parvula, Streptococcus parasanguinis, Dorea formicigenerans, Bifidobacterium adolescentis, Lachnospiraceae bacterium 7 1 58FAA, Escherichia coli, Streptococcus salivarius, Klebsiella pneumoniae, Bifidobacterium longum, and Lachnospiraceae Bacterium 5 1 63FAA, distinguished TAK patients from controls with areas under the curve (AUCs) of 87.8%, 85.9%, 81.1%, and 71.1% in training, test, and validation sets including healthy or BD controls, respectively. Diagnostic species were directly or indirectly (via metabolites or lipids) correlated with TAK phenotypes of vascular involvement, inflammation, discharge medication, and prognosis. External validation against publicly metagenomic studies (n = 184) on hypertension, atrial fibrillation, and healthy controls, confirmed the diagnostic accuracy of the model for TAK.ConclusionThis study first identifies the discriminatory gut microbes in TAK. Dysbiotic microbes are also linked to TAK phenotypes directly or indirectly via metabolic and lipid modules. Further explorations of the microbiome–metagenome interface in TAK subtype prediction and pathogenesis are suggested.

目的 分析近2年高血压住院患者中内分泌性高血压的病因构成及临床特点.方法 回顾性分析阜外医院高血压病房2016年1月至2017年12月因高血压首次住院的患者中内分泌性高血压的病因构成及基本临床情况.结果 高血压患者4782例,其中内分泌性高血压371例,占7.76%.内分泌性高血压的病因构成为:原发性醛固酮增多症247例(66.58%),甲状腺功能减退症52例(14.02%),甲状腺功能亢进症38例(10.24%),多囊卵巢综合征22例(5.93%),皮质醇增多症8例(2.16%),嗜铬细胞瘤4例(1.08%).与原发性高血压组[(50.31±15.10)岁]相比,原发性醛固酮增多症组年龄稍小[(48.21±11.63)岁],甲状腺功能异常组年龄较大[(55.20±14.68)岁],多囊卵巢综合征组明显年轻[(33.03±3.0l)岁],差异均有统计学意义(P<0.05).原发性醛固酮增多症组中男性占59.92%,甲状腺功能异常组中女性占56.67%,多囊卵巢综合征组均为育龄期年轻女性,皮质醇增多症组以青年女性为主(占75%).与原发性高血压组相比,内分泌性高血压组血压高[收缩压:(150.23±20.51) mmHg比(143.21±20.01)mmHg,舒张压:(91.38±15.72) mmHg比(87.20±15.03) mmHg],尿微量白蛋白/肌酐高[(43.12±79.41) mg/g比(39.41±134.57) mg/g],并发外周动脉狭窄/闭塞者多(9.43%比4.13%),差异均有统计学意义(P<0.001).结论 内分泌性高血压并不少见,原发性醛固酮增多症是最常见病因.内分泌性高血压多为中青年患者,且血压高,靶器官损害重.
Objective: Evidence-based studies on endovascular approaches for childhood Takayasu arteritis(c-TA) are limited. This study presented the real-world scenario of largest cohort up-to-date for c-TA patients undergoing interventions and their post-interventional outcomes. Design and method: Patients with c-TA satisfying the 1990 ACR or 2010 EULAR/PRINTO/PReS criteria were recruited from January 2002 to December 2017. Data on clinical, laboratory, imaging features, treatment and post-interventional outcomes were collected. Statistical analysis was performed based on data distribution. Complication-free survival and Re-intervention-free survival were projected by Kaplan-Meier methods and compared by Log-rank tests. Associated factors for intervention (or stenting) and predictors for post-interventional complications (or re-interventions) were assessed via Logistic regression and COX regression models, respectively. Results: Among 101 patients enrolled, 69(68.3%) underwent 121 interventions (Angioplasty 95; Stenting 26) during a median 3.1 years of follow-up. Compared with the medical treatment group, the intervention group appeared with fewer male population(18.8% vs 39.3%, OR = 0.2, p = 0.017) and more type IV disease(47.8% vs. 17.9%, OR = 10.60, p = 0.002). Male sex also indicated the risk for re-intervention(HR = 4.72, p = 0.016). Retinopathy(OR = 4.8, p = 0.027), time of delay in diagnosis per year(OR = 1.76, p = 0.016) and descending thoracic aorta involvement(OR = 10.19, p = 0.003) associated with stent insertion. Hypertension secondary to renal artery(59.4%) or mid-aorta(14.5%) stenosis, heart failure(21.7%), claudication(21.7%) served as leading clinical hints for interventions. Anti-inflammatory and anti-platelet therapies covered 89.9% and 91.3% patients, respectively. The technical success rate was 96.7%. Over median 2.88 years since intervention, 36 lesions occurred complications in 28 patients and 22 lesions in 17 patients, majorly on renal artery or mid-aorta. The 5-year complication-free and re-intervention survivals were 50.7% and 65.8%, separately. Dual antiplatelet therapy(HR = 0.28, p = 0.011), concurrent surgery(HR = 14.84, p = 0.002), retinopathy secondary to hypertension(HR = 3.54, p = 0.004), and pulmonary artery hypertension(HR = 3.0, p = 0.024) were independent predictors for complications. Conclusions: Over two-thirds c-TA patients require interventions and the 5-year complication-free survival is 50.7%. Male sex, retinopathy, and pulmonary artery hypertension alert unfavorable outcomes. Dual anti-platelet therapy appears to protect c-TA patients from post-interventional complications. Endovascular approaches can be a choice for mid-aorta and/or renal artery lesions caused by c-TA.
Objective To analyze the causes of renal artery stenosis (RAS) and compare the clinical characteristics in accordance with the primary disease among patients aged from 30 to 50. Methods Patients were grouped by etiologies of RAS. Groups were retrospectively examined and compared regarding demographic data, clinical manifestations, laboratory findings, and imaging findings. Results A total of 152 patients (74 females, 78 males; mean age: 40.70 ± 6.01 years) were enrolled, including 84 patients (55.3%) with atherosclerosis (AS), 46 patients (30.3%) with Takayasu arteritis (TA), 18 patients (11.8%) with fibromuscular dysplasia (FMD), and four patients (2.6%) with other etiologies. Patients in AS group had greater body mass index, higher prevalence of comorbidities and higher rate of smoking and drinking history. TA patients showed more constitutional symptoms and vascular findings, and higher erythrocyte sedimentation rate. RAS in both AS group and TA group mainly located on ostia and proximal segments, but RAS in FMD group mainly involved middle to distal segment of renal artery. The AS group had significantly lesser stenosis than the other groups. Although renal function evaluated by the estimated glomerular filtration rate did not significantly differ among the groups, the incidence of kidney shrinkage was significantly higher in the TA and FMD groups (39.1% and 50%, respectively) than in the AS group (8.3%). The FMD group had milder cardiac damage than other groups. Conclusions AS was the most common cause of RAS in patients aged from 30 to 50, followed by TA and FMD. The etiology of RAS should be carefully distinguished based on clinical manifestations, laboratory findings, and imaging to ensure that proper treatment is provided.
Background Pheochromocytoma and paraganglioma is a rare disease with a prevalence of 0.2-0.6% in hypertensive patients from outpatient. Case summary A 21-year-old man complained of blood pressure elevation over one year and persistent hyperhidrosis near 5 years. In local hospital, a mass in the pericardial space with abundant blood flow was observed via echocardiography and confirmed under minimally invasive thoracotomy. With suspicion of malignant cardiac mass, the patient was recommended to transfer for further diagnosis and treatment. Combining evaluation for blood and urinary catecholamine levels, somatostatin receptor imaging, and iodine-131 metaiodobenzylguanidine scintigraphy, he was confirmed with the diagnosis of cardiac paraganglioma with blood supply from the right coronary artery identified via angiography. The cardiac tumour was then surgically resected and confirmed with a pathological diagnosis of paraganglioma. Subsequent genetic test suggested succinate dehydrogenase complex iron sulfur subunit B (SDHB) gene mutation. At 5-month follow-up, the patient was recovered with normal levels of blood catecholamines and catecholamine metabolites. Discussion Cardiac paraganglioma should be considered and evaluated in hypertensive patients with cardiac mass, even in non-typical population. Given a potential risk of developing malignancies, close follow-up is significant in patients with SDHB gene mutations.
Glucocorticoid-remediable aldosteronism (GRA) is an autosomal-dominant inherited aldosteronism that is often accompanied by early-onset hypertension. GRA is caused by the unequal crossover of the 11β-hydroxylase (CYP11B1) and aldosterone synthase (CYP11B2) genes. As a result of chimeric gene duplication, aldosterone is ectopically synthesized in the adrenal zona fasciculata under the control of adrenocorticotropic hormone (ACTH). Here, we describe a Chinese pedigree with three affected subjects. Both the uncle and nephew were hospitalized in our hospital due to early-onset hypertension (onset <20 years old) and were diagnosed with primary aldosteronism (PA). Their laboratory test results revealed hyperaldosteronism, hyporeninemia, a high plasma aldosterone to renin (ARR) ratio, and normal serum potassium (K+). Captopril failed to suppress aldosterone secretion. This family had a strong paternal history of hypertension. Thirteen members underwent gene testing, and three of them were found to be GRA positive. Through long-extension PCR (XL-PCR) and direct sequencing, we identified the CYP11B1/CYP11B2 chimeric gene, and with unequal crossover breakpoints located between intron 2 of CYP11B1 and exon 3 of CYP11B2 in the three patients. Low-dose dexamethasone was effective. This is the first family report of GRA in northern China. Moreover, a case of GRA combined with a CACNA1H gene mutation is reported for the first time. We found that dihydropyridine calcium channel blockers (CCBs) combined with aldosterone receptor antagonists exerted good therapeutic effects in controlling blood pressure in GRA patients for whom glucocorticoid therapy was not an option.
Background: Chronic heart failure (CHF) is a serious complication and a major cause of mortality in patients with Takayasu arteritis (TA). We aimed to explore the clinical features and long-term outcomes in TA patients with CHF. Methods and results: Adult TA patients admitted to our hospital between January 2009 to April 2018 were classified as Hr and non-HF group. The adverse events were defined as a composite of all-cause mortality and hospitalization for HF. The outcome of the HF-group was further analyzed. A total of 61 HF patients and 102 non-HF patients were identified. In the HF group, the median age at assessment was 41.9 years, and female was predominant (82.0%). The multivariable logistic regression model revealed that pulmonary hypertension, aortic regurgitation, mitral regurgitation, level albumin, and uric acid were independently associated with CHI. After a median follow-up of 1347 days, 25 adverse events occurred in HI patients, and the 5-year event-free rate was 54.7%. The Cox model showed that coronary artery involvement, aortic regurgitation, without interventional treatment were related to adverse events. Conclusions: The 5-year event-free rate was not satisfying. Aggressive intervention may decreased the likelihood of adverse events in patients with CHF. (C) 2020 Elsevier B.V. All rights reserved.
目的 基于单中心临床治疗成本数据,对英夫利西单抗(Infliximab,IFX)纳入医保前后和沙利度胺(Thalidomide,THA)、甲氨蝶呤(Methotrexate,MTX)在复发克罗恩病(Crohn's disease,CD)治疗中的成本-效用进行比较分析.方法 纳入2009年10月1日至2018年9月30日采用THA、MTX和IFX治疗的复发CD患者,收集其直接医疗成本和CD疾病活动度评分(Crohn's disease activity index,CDAI).IFX纳入医保后的相应成本由IFX医保前后费用差价算得.质量调整寿命年(quality adjusted life year,QALY)由CDAI换算得来,QALY原始算法基于EQ-5D量表换算得来.以THA治疗方案为参照进行成本-效用分析,2018年人均GDP为成本-效用评估阈值标准.结果 在IFX纳入医保前后,对复发CD患者而言,THA方案人均直接医疗成本最低(0.80万元).而相对于THA治疗方案,增加单位QALY的不同治疗方案费用:MTX治疗方案花费100万元,IFX纳入医保前需花费133.67万元,但在IFX纳入医保后仅需消耗1.87万元,远低于2018年人均GDP.结论 IFX纳入医保后成为复发CD患者极具成本-效用优势的药物治疗方案.
